Overview:


Little Hartley is a small rural village located in the Blue Mountains region of New South Wales, Australia. It is situated approximately 150 kilometers west of Sydney and falls within the local government area of the City of Lithgow. With a population of around 200 people, Little Hartley offers a peaceful and picturesque setting, surrounded by stunning natural landscapes.

Transport & Access:


Little Hartley is easily accessible by road, with the Great Western Highway passing through the village. It is approximately a two-hour drive from Sydney, making it a convenient destination for a day trip or a weekend getaway. The nearest train station is located in Lithgow, which is about a 15-minute drive away.

Things to Do:


Despite its small size, Little Hartley offers a range of activities and attractions for visitors to enjoy. Some popular things to do in and around Little Hartley include:

1. Hartley Historic Site: Explore the well-preserved colonial buildings and learn about the area's history at this heritage site.
2. Bushwalking: Take a hike through the beautiful Blue Mountains National Park, which offers numerous walking trails and stunning lookout points.
3. Jenolan Caves: Visit the nearby Jenolan Caves, one of the world's oldest cave systems, and marvel at the breathtaking limestone formations.
4. Scenic Drives: Enjoy scenic drives through the picturesque countryside, taking in the stunning views of the Blue Mountains and surrounding valleys.
5. Local Cafes and Restaurants: Sample delicious local cuisine and enjoy a meal at one of the charming cafes or restaurants in the area.

Nearby Neighborhoods:


Little Hartley is surrounded by several other small towns and villages, each offering its own unique charm. Some nearby neighborhoods include:

1. Hartley Vale: Located just a short distance from Little Hartley, Hartley Vale is known for its historic buildings and scenic beauty.
2. Lithgow: The largest town in the area, Lithgow offers a range of amenities, including shopping centers, restaurants, and cultural attractions.
3. Mount Victoria: Situated on the western edge of the Blue Mountains, Mount Victoria is known for its stunning views and historic buildings.
4. Blackheath: A popular tourist destination, Blackheath is renowned for its natural beauty, including the famous Govetts Leap lookout and the stunning Blue Mountains National Park.
